A Greener Gleam: Slashing Carbon Footprints with Robotic Precision

For decades, the standard approach to facade routine maintenance has relied seriously on fossil fuels. The diesel generators powering large-rise cradles and the gas consumed by cranes and transportation autos contribute on to city air pollution and a setting up’s Over-all carbon footprint. This Vitality-intense design stands in stark distinction to your core rules of environmentally friendly architecture.

From Fossil Fuels to Battery electrical power

the main and many immediate environmental benefit of fashionable cleaning robots is their electrical power resource. the newest generation of automated cleansing methods operates on superior-capacity, rechargeable batteries. this easy change from inside combustion engines to electric powered power yields spectacular outcomes. It removes localized emissions of carbon dioxide, nitrogen oxides, and particulate issue, contributing to much healthier air top quality in dense city centers. Additionally, these batteries might be charged making use of electrical energy from renewable resources like photo voltaic or wind, allowing for a making to accomplish a nearly zero-emission cleaning cycle. This transfer aligns correctly with the global drive towards electrification and decarbonization.

Precision that stops Waste

outside of the Power resource, robotic units introduce a volume of precision that human operators can hardly ever match. Programmed with intelligent route-scheduling algorithms, these robots apply h2o and cleaning brokers with meticulous precision. They use simply enough to achieve a great clean up, removing the wasteful overspray and runoff widespread in guide washing. This controlled source administration not merely conserves wide quantities of h2o over a developing's lifecycle but will also reduces the volume of cleaning chemical compounds introduced to the ecosystem. When you can evaluate and enhance each and every milliliter of water made use of, you are participating in a truly sustainable follow.

From superior-threat to substantial-Tech: Prioritizing Human protection in the Dangerous occupation

substantial-angle work is constantly rated among the most harmful occupations globally. Window cleaners deal with the continuous challenges of falls from top, equipment failure, sudden wind gusts, and electrical hazards. every single ascent is usually a calculated possibility, and Regardless of rigorous security protocols, incidents continue to be a tragic actuality. The introduction of robotics fundamentally alterations this equation by eliminating the human element from The purpose of Threat.

doing away with the Human component from Threat Zones

A robotic cleaning procedure is managed remotely by a qualified operator stationed safely on the bottom or rooftop. This one transform eradicates the most significant pitfalls related to The task. there won't be any life hanging from the rope countless feet while in the air. The physical pressure, climate publicity, and psychological pressure endured by handbook cleaners are fully eradicated. inside their put is usually a know-how-driven procedure monitored from the safe area, transforming a large-risk career into a complex, zero-hazard job.

The Evolution of Positions, Not Their Elimination

a typical fear surrounding automation is task displacement. nonetheless, inside the context of facade cleaning, this development is healthier referred to as task transformation. The demand for cleansing won't disappear; somewhat, the skills required to conduct The task evolve. Manual laborers have the opportunity to turn out to be experienced robot operators, upkeep technicians, and logistics supervisors. This transition elevates the workforce, making safer, bigger-spending, plus more technologically Sophisticated job paths. It signifies an expenditure in human capital, shifting employees from perilous guide jobs to roles centered on Command, diagnostics, and technique management.

setting up the long run: Robots like a Cornerstone of Smart Cities and Sustainable Infrastructure

The idea of a wise City is crafted on the thought of employing details and engineering to produce extra effective, sustainable, and livable city environments. window cleaning robot solution environmentally friendly making cleansing robots certainly are a tangible application of this philosophy, performing as a essential bit of clever infrastructure.

Aligning with eco-friendly setting up criteria

Prestigious environmentally friendly setting up certifications like LEED (Leadership in Power and Environmental Design) and BREEAM (Building investigation Establishment Environmental evaluation system) Appraise a building's functionality throughout quite a few metrics, which include sustainable website management and operational innovation. Employing a robotic cleansing solution that cuts down Power use, conserves water, and boosts worker safety is a powerful, demonstrable action that aligns with these standards. Building house owners in search of to realize or preserve these certifications can issue to their automatic maintenance system as evidence of their commitment to sustainability in action.

the info-Driven Approach to servicing

Smart robots do extra than simply clean up; they collect info. since they traverse a making's facade, they are often Outfitted with sensors to map their progress, measure cleaning performance, and also discover likely upkeep problems like cracked glass or failing seals. This details enables facility supervisors to shift from the reactive, timetable-based cleaning model to some predictive, situation-based mostly a person. they could deploy means extra properly, timetable cleanings dependant on precise want, and gain further insights into their developing's overall health, creating the whole operation smarter and more Price-powerful.

The Economics of Automation: Maximizing effectiveness and Return on expense

when the protection and environmental Advantages are persuasive, any new engineering need to also be monetarily feasible. For developing owners and residence administration corporations, robotic cleaning methods characterize a big extended-phrase expenditure with a clear and interesting return on expenditure (ROI).

Unprecedented pace and Coverage

The sheer performance of a contemporary substantial increase creating window cleansing tools robot is staggering. prime-tier designs can thoroughly clean upwards of 720 square meters for each hour, a amount that far surpasses what a team of guide cleaners can attain. This speed ensures that a setting up’s complete facade is often cleaned inside of a portion of some time, minimizing disruption to tenants and sustaining a regularly pristine appearance. for big professional Attributes, motels, and household towers, this pace interprets instantly into operational agility and minimized downtime.

Calculating the correct Price: Beyond Labor

The ROI of the robotic procedure extends significantly over and above merely comparing the equipment's cost to hourly labor wages. The genuine calculation features a large number of prevented expenditures. insurance plan rates for high-risk operate are greatly lessened or eliminated. The recurring costs of renting, transporting, and starting scaffolding or cradles vanish. the necessity for much larger cleaning crews is diminished, additional cutting labor expenses. When viewed holistically, the initial capital outlay for your robotic program is usually recouped surprisingly speedily by these amassed operational savings, rendering it not only the greener decision, but the greater lucrative one Over time.
